Helmsdale RNLI

Over the Christmas period, the team had various fundraising activities:

Mrs F Sutherland sold Lifeboat Cards at the Craft Fair in November in the community centre and raised £70.

There was a beautiful Christmas cake baked and donated by one of the stalwart supporters, which was put up for raffle in the La Mirage restaurant. The winning ticket was drawn on Christmas Eve and won by Mrs C Bokas, Portgower. The raffle was very successful, bringing in £70 for the RNLI new "Lifejacket Appeal".

The team then turned their attention to organising a Pool Competition and Raffle for Hogmanay in the Bannockburn Inn which turned out to be as equally successful, the first prize of a hamper again going to Mrs Bokas. However there were lots of other raffle prizes to be won.

The pool competition itself was won by Fergus McFarlane- Barrow, Helmsdale, who won the RNLI Shield and a haunch of venison. Runner-up was Philip Marshall, Helmsdale, winning a bottle of whisky.

This competition is gaining in popularity since it was started four years ago. This year's total for the pool event was £240.

RNLI headquarters in Poole say that this year their main aim is to issue the Lifeboat Crew with the latest lifejackets which have been scientifically enhanced for the protection of the crews, so all money raised was sent to Poole to help with that project.
